rxtx相关内容

RXTX 无法在 ubuntu 上列出端口

我正在尝试运行简单的代码: import java.io.BufferedReader;导入 java.io.InputStreamReader;导入 java.io.OutputStream;导入 gnu.io.CommPortIdentifier;导入 gnu.io.SerialPort;导入 gnu.io.SerialPortEvent;导入 gnu.io.SerialPortEventL ..
发布时间:2021-07-20 18:39:32 Java开发

Ubuntu RXTX 无法识别 USB 串行设备

我正在将带有 librxtx-java 的设备连接到 Ubuntu.该代码以前在 10.04 中有效,但在 12.04 中无法发现连接到计算机的 USB 串口. java.util.EnumerationportEnum = CommPortIdentifier.getPortIdentifiers();while ( portEnum.hasMoreElements() ){CommPortI ..
发布时间:2021-07-20 18:33:47 Java开发

Java Marine API-寻找NMEA数据

我的最终目标是从Adafruit Ultimate GPS(标准为NMEA 0183)接收纬度和经度GPS信息到我的Java应用程序.我正在使用Java Marine API来做到这一点.然后,当前位置将与时间戳一起写入数据库. 到目前为止,我已经成功(我认为)将RXTX配置为通过USB端口启用coms.Java Marine API附带了一些示例.java文件.下面的示例应扫描所有现有的C ..
发布时间:2021-05-13 18:40:11 Java开发

Java RXTXcomm lib连接到/ dev / ttyACM0

我正在使用RXXTX java lib连接到串行端口。我使用这个lib可以毫无问题地连接到/ dev / ttyUSB0(1、2、3等)。 但是当我想连接到/ dev / ttyACM0端口未找到。 CommPortIdentifier portIdentifier = CommPortIdentifier.getPortIdentifier(“ / dev / ttyACM0”); ..
发布时间:2020-10-06 07:48:30 Java开发

RXTX版本不匹配

我找到了一个通过Java通过串行端口与Arduino进行通信的代码,并想尝试使其正常工作以扩展其在项目上的想法,但我一直遇到此错误 Stable Library ========================================= Native lib Version = RXTX-2.2-20081207 Cloudhopper Build rxtx.cloudhopper. ..
发布时间:2020-09-06 21:12:06 Java开发

如何修复Windows 10中的Java rxtxSerial.dll或jSSC-2.7_x86_64.dll串行端口错误?

更新:我已经找到了通过使用jSerialComm库的解决方案. (请参阅底部的代码) 我有一个程序,我们已经在Windows 7机器上运行了一段时间,但是现在开始引入Windows 10机器,并且程序崩溃.所以我需要找到一个解决方案. 该错误是EXCEPTION_ACCESS_VIOLATION错误. (请参见下文) 下面的第一段代码是我自己的代码,它使用rxtxSerial.d ..
发布时间:2020-05-29 01:37:50 其他开发

如何使用OSGi Equinox设置rxtx?

我正在寻找解决问题的方法. 我正在开发一个必须通过rxtx jar从串行端口读取的包. 启动应用程序时,出现以下错误 java.lang.UnsatisfiedLinkError: no rxtxSerial in java.library.path thrown while loading gnu.io.RXTXCommDriver Exception in thread "Threa ..
发布时间:2020-05-22 19:20:51 Java开发

在我的Raspberry中安装rxtx捆绑包

我想在Raspberry Pi上安装rxtx捆绑包 该捆绑包将在KURA平台上运行(Equinox是Kura的OSGi容器) 我使用以下命令安装了rxtx本机库: sudo apt-get install librxtx-java .so已安装在以下目录中:/usr/lib/jni/ pi@raspberrypi /usr/lib/jni $ ls librxtxI2C-2.2p ..
发布时间:2020-05-01 10:30:59 Java开发

在Linux上具有零端口的CommPortIdentifier.getPortIdentifiers

我正在尝试在ubuntu上连接串行端口.但是,它对我不起作用.我成功地在Windows上使用不同的驱动程序运行了相同的项目.问题是我在使用此端口时无法加载任何端口: CommPortIdentifier.getPortIdentifiers(); //我正在使用rxtx 2.1.7 它总是返回零端口.我想使用端口ttyS0,该端口可与minicon一起很好地工作,因此我确定端口未阻塞且 ..
发布时间:2020-05-01 10:06:55 Java开发

inputstream.available()始终为0

我不知道我的代码正在发生什么.我没有错误,也没有回应.我正在将数据写入串行端口,并通过激活port.notifyOnDataAvailable(true);等待响应,但是不会触发此事件,并且inputstream.available()始终返回0.可能是什么问题?我在Linux中使用RXTX. 编辑 package testConn; import forms_helper.glo ..
发布时间:2020-05-01 08:47:01 Java开发

Java RXTX和包装

我有一个内置netbeans的java程序,它使用来自这里。到目前为止,它在Windows和Linux中都运行良好。 我的问题:是否可以在JAR中包含所需的RXTX文件而无需按照上的说明安装它们RXTX网站。我希望能够将所有包含文件的JAR交给Linux或Windows上的人,并让它正常工作。 这是可能的,什么是最好的这样做的方法? 谢谢。 解决方案 你不要不需要安装它们 ..
发布时间:2019-01-15 11:14:10 Java开发

我想在java中使用RxTx通过串口检测设备

我想在java中使用RxTx通过串口检测设备,并且设备被编程为如果它从计算机收到特定字,它将回复“ok”并且如果计算机收到ok ...它将停止发送单词和突出显示设备已连接。请帮我。还有一件事......我必须检查每个端口..请您编写一个自动循环通过端口的方法,直到检测到设备。 我的代码即使在无限循环中也只发送一次这个词。 code: private void cb1KeyPressed ..
发布时间:2019-01-08 19:11:41 Java开发

是否必须在RXTX中进行常规轮询?

在尝试找出此问题时(感谢任何帮助),我跑了RXTX使用 PortMon 监控其活动,并注意到RXTX会不断检查是否即使Java客户端仅通过SerialPortEventListener从gnu.io.SerialPort对象读取数据,也可以使用数据。 这是为什么?这是RXTX人员糟糕的实现选择,Sun的API选择不好(因为RXTX遵循javax.comm API),或者本机代码支持运行Jav ..
发布时间:2018-12-28 15:01:27 Java开发

Windows上的RxTx安装java.lang.NoClassDefFoundError:gnu / io / CommPort

我把 rxtxcomm.jar 放到 jre / lib / ext 文件夹中,但我仍然得到 NoClassDefFoundError 这个文件夹不会自动进入全局类路径吗? 谢谢 解决方案 是的,它会被自动带到类路径,但RXTXcomm使用JNI /本机外部库(.so和.dll文件),在运行程序时必须提供它们的路径命令行: java -jar yourprogram.jar ..
发布时间:2018-12-07 19:16:40 Java开发

在RXTX中收到的问题

我一直在使用RXTX大约一年,没有太多问题。我刚开始一个新的程序与一个新的硬件进行交互,所以我重用了我在其他项目中使用的connect()方法,但我有一个我以前从未见过的奇怪问题。 问题 设备工作正常,因为当我连接HyperTerminal时,我发送东西并收到我的期望,并且串行端口监视器(SPM)反映了这一点。 然而,当我运行简单的HyperTerminal-clone时,我编写 ..
发布时间:2018-12-05 10:12:03 Java开发

RXTX的稳定替代品

在将RXTX用于许多不同的项目之后,我遇到了许多烦人的差异和问题,这些问题只能明智地归结为库中的错误 - 死锁,竞争危险以及RXTX库深处的监控线程open open阻止程序关闭(即使我正在使用的所有端口都已关闭!)运行最新的“不稳定”版本有所帮助,但它仍然远离我称之为可靠的地方,以及项目上的活动目前似乎相当低。 但是,搜索RXTX的免费跨平台替代品似乎没有提出太多其他内容。 是否有其 ..
发布时间:2018-11-29 20:06:23 Java开发